Description

Sarah watches the classic movie "Witness," and tells Harrison Ford that this will happen again in about 40 years with a cast member on VPR. So she Zooms up another witness to a horrible crime (Sandoval's interview with Howie Mandel), Jackelyn Shultz (producer and podcaster, whose credits include "Howie Mandel Does Stuff," which she hosts with her dad). They discuss the fallout from the Howie interview (and the reason why there wasn't a counter to Sandoval's ever-shifting narrative), a manipulative use of couples therapy in Tom's storytelling, why the Scandoval nearly cost Ariana Something About Her, Tom's possible use of a loan as a form of self preservation, and yes, why an 80 min monologue from Sandoval is probably the most honest window into who he is. Andy's Girls with Sarah Galli is a semiweekly podcast that dives deep into the drama on and off Bravo TV. A mix of C-SPAN and "Iyanla Fix My Life," episodes focus on the psychology behind the Real Housewives franchise. Named a 'Certified Bravoholic' by Bravo, Sarah is joined by rotating guest co-hosts, from Real Housewives themselves to prominent culture writers, comedians, and Bravoholics.
